The market for high-speed steel was estimated to be worth US$2.6 billion in 2022, and from 2023 to 2033, it is anticipated to increase at a 6.7% CAGR. According to estimates, the high-speed steel market will generate US$ 2.7 billion in sales in 2023 and US$ 5.2 billion by the end of 2033.

High-speed steels, sometimes known as HSS, are a class of steel alloys that are best known for their rapid cutting and machining capabilities. It is frequently utilised in drill bits and power-saw blades. Due to its ability to endure higher temperatures without losing its temper, high-speed steel outperforms earlier high-carbon steel tools in this regard.

Why the Demand for High-Speed Steel is Growing Faster in China Compared to Other Countries?

The construction sector, which is Asia’s largest user of steel, is anticipated to grow significantly throughout the forecasted period. Nearly two thirds of all steel consumed in Asian countries are used for building, which is continuing to be good news for the market’s expansion for high-speed steel.

One of the main manufacturing sectors in the nation is the automotive sector. More than half of the autos in the Asia-Pacific area are made in China. Due to China’s status as a developing nation, the need for HSS will rise as infrastructure spending continues to rise.
